Why does my Minecraft keep kicking me out of servers?

Possible solutions are: Check that your network connection is enabled, and that no programs are blocking outgoing connections. Try disabling any existing firewall program, or changing its configuration options. Restart your modem/router.

How do you fix Desync in Minecraft?

Possible solutions tell is that we can employ a number of fixes:

  1. Reduce the value of the “400” literal to a lower number, to force more frequent absolute positioning packets.
  2. Provide a command to the player to force more absolute positioning packets.
  3. Implement Mojang’s 1.8 solution to the 1.7 server.

Why is my connection so bad Minecraft?

The most popular and regular reason for Minecraft Lag in the multiplayer mode of the game is due to high Latency. What this means is that your internet connection is not reliable or gaming optimized causing a bad game connection.

How do I fix authentication is not currently reachable?

Remove MCLeaks or any AltDispencers, run a full virus scan, run a maleware scan, change your Minecraft password and any other passwords that maybe the same as your Minecraft one as MCLeaks will have stolen it and clean your HOSTS file by removing any lines related to Mojang.
